Reverse phone lookup apps have become increasingly popular due to their ability to provide quick and easy access to information about unknown callers. These apps leverage vast databases to reveal details about the person or business associated with a particular phone number. The best apps in this category offer a combination of accuracy, ease of use, and additional features that enhance the overall user experience.

Key Features to Consider
  • Database Size and Accuracy: The core of any reverse phone lookup app is its database. A larger and more accurate database increases the likelihood of finding reliable information. Apps that update their databases regularly tend to provide more accurate results.
  • User Interface: An intuitive and user-friendly interface makes the process of conducting a lookup seamless. Look for apps with straightforward navigation and clear instructions.
  • Additional Features: Many apps offer added functionalities such as caller ID, spam call blocking, and integration with your contacts. These features can provide a more comprehensive solution to managing unknown calls.

After extensive research and user feedback, several apps have emerged as frontrunners in the reverse phone lookup arena. Among them, Truecaller, Hiya, and Whitepages stand out for their robust databases and user-friendly designs. Truecaller is particularly popular due to its global reach and extensive features, including call blocking and SMS filtering. Hiya is renowned for its simplicity and effectiveness in identifying spam calls, while Whitepages offers a comprehensive directory that includes both landline and mobile numbers.

It's important to note that while reverse phone lookup apps can be incredibly useful, they do have limitations. The accuracy of the information can vary depending on the source of the data and the privacy settings of the phone number in question. Additionally, some apps may require a subscription or in-app purchases to access premium features. Therefore, it's crucial to weigh the benefits against the costs when selecting the right app for your needs.
